【首发】Unix系统应用性能管理与优化指南
在Unix系统下,应用性能管理与优化是一项至关重要的任务。Unix作为一种稳定、高效的操作系统,广泛应用于服务器、大型计算机和嵌入式系统等领域。然而,随着应用程序的日益复杂和用户需求的不断增长,如何确保应用的性能稳定并持续提高成为了亟待解决的问题。 应用性能管理(APM)是一个综合性的过程,它涉及到对应用程序的监控、分析和优化。在Unix系统下,我们可以通过各种工具和技术来实现这一目标。我们需要对应用程序进行全面的监控,包括CPU使用率、内存消耗、磁盘I/O、网络带宽等关键指标。这些监控数据可以帮助我们了解应用程序的运行状态,及时发现潜在的性能瓶颈。 我们需要对监控数据进行深入的分析。通过分析数据,我们可以找到应用程序性能问题的根源,例如代码中的瓶颈、资源争用、锁冲突等。这些分析结果将为我们提供优化应用程序的依据。 在优化应用程序时,我们需要关注多个方面。我们可以从代码层面进行优化,通过改进算法、减少不必要的计算、优化数据结构等方式来提高应用程序的性能。我们还可以从系统层面进行优化,例如调整系统参数、优化文件系统、增加缓存等。这些优化措施将有助于提高应用程序的响应速度和吞吐量。 2025AI图片创制,仅供参考 除了以上提到的措施外,还有一些其他的优化方法值得我们关注。例如,我们可以通过负载均衡技术将应用程序分布到多个服务器上,以提高系统的整体性能和可靠性。另外,我们还可以利用容器化技术来实现应用程序的快速部署和隔离,从而提高系统的灵活性和可扩展性。站长个人见解,在Unix系统下进行应用性能管理与优化是一项复杂而重要的任务。通过全面的监控、深入的分析和有效的优化措施,我们可以确保应用程序的性能稳定并持续提高,从而满足不断增长的用户需求。 (编辑:晋中站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|